ALITHYA BUYS FIRM FOR $56.4 MILLION Featured

UmbrellaThe Alithya Group, based in Montreal, Que., has agreed to acquire Datum Consulting Group for up to $56.4 million. The purchase of the Indianapolis, Ind.-based firm includes a maximum potential earnout of $13 million.

Datum specializes in providing IT services to insurance companies and other regulated entities. Alithya, which sells Dynamics and Oracle. Datum employs more than 150 worldwide and had revenue of $18 million for the year ended December 31. That adds to the $395.9 million in revenue reported for Alithya for the same year, which placed it No. 2 on Bob Scott’s Top 100 VARs. Datum's workforce encompasses insurance subject matter experts who have worked with Healthcare, Property and Casualty, and Life Annuity insurance companies. Early in 2022, Alithya bought Bala Cynwyd, Pa.-based Vitalyst for $49.2 million. Vitalyst markets on-demand, subscription-based Adaptive Learning to Fortune 1000 companies, offering services for the adoption of Microsoft cloud applications
